The Costa del Sol car market in numbers

Malaga province has one of the most expensive used car markets in Spain. A 3-year-old Mercedes GLC 220d lists at 42,000-46,000 EUR in Marbella dealerships; the same car in Munich sells for 33,000-36,000 EUR. A 2-year-old Porsche Macan is 68,000 EUR locally versus 55,000 EUR in Stuttgart. Demand from wealthy international residents, limited supply and the ITP transfer tax of 8% in Andalusia on local used purchases (on the official value, capped for older cars) all push prices up. Importing from Germany or the Netherlands, paying IEDMT instead of ITP and choosing a low-CO2 model, routinely saves 15-25%.

Which cars are worth importing to Marbella

  • Premium SUVs: Mercedes GLC and GLE, BMW X3 and X5, Audi Q5 and Q7, Porsche Macan and Cayenne. Huge choice in Germany, savings of 7,000-15,000 EUR after tax.
  • Plug-in hybrids: BMW 330e, Mercedes C300e, Volvo XC60 T6 Recharge, Range Rover Evoque PHEV. At under 50 g/km they pay 0% IEDMT, which is the biggest single lever on a premium import.
  • EVs: Tesla Model Y and 3, BMW iX, Mercedes EQE, Porsche Taycan. 0% IEDMT and Dutch and German used EV prices are still soft.
  • Convertibles and coupes for the climate: Mercedes E-Class Cabrio, BMW 4 Series Convertible, Porsche 718 Boxster. These have low mileage and good history in Germany.
  • Not worth it: high-CO2 V8s over 200 g/km unless very cheap abroad, because 14.75% IEDMT erases much of the saving; and old right-hand drive UK cars.

UK expats: bring the car or buy in Germany?

The Costa del Sol has the largest British population in Spain, and since Brexit the calculation has shifted. If you are relocating and your car qualifies for the transfer-of-residence exemption (owned 6 months, applied within 60 days of residence, kept 12 months), bringing it is free of duty, VAT and IEDMT; you pay LHD headlights (350-2,500 EUR), CoC, ITV and DGT. If you do not qualify, a UK car pays 21% VAT plus IEDMT plus customs fees, and a left-hand drive equivalent from Germany is almost always cheaper and easier to sell on later. Right-hand drive cars trade at a 15-25% discount on the Spanish used market when you come to sell.

Local logistics: ITV, DGT and town halls

  • ITV stations for pre-registration: Malaga (several), Marbella (San Pedro de Alcantara), Estepona, Fuengirola, Velez-Malaga. Book online; San Pedro and Malaga capital are the most used by importers. 45-70 EUR.
  • DGT Malaga office: appointment required, typically 1-2 weeks; professional registration through a gestor or importer skips the queue.
  • Padron: Marbella, Estepona, Mijas, Benalmadena and Fuengirola town halls issue the certificate the same day with a rental contract or deed. Some ask for an in-person appointment.
  • IVTM road tax: Marbella is among the pricier municipalities for high-power cars (around 220 EUR for a 200 hp car); Mijas and Estepona are lower. EVs get 75% discounts in most Costa municipalities.
  • Transport: a car from Germany reaches Malaga province by truck in 5-8 days, 900-1,200 EUR; from the Netherlands 1,000-1,300 EUR.

Worked example: 2023 Mercedes GLC 300e from Germany to Marbella

  • Purchase in Germany: 44,500 EUR (Marbella dealer price for equivalent: 56,000-59,000 EUR)
  • Transport to Marbella: 1,100 EUR
  • CoC: 180 EUR
  • ITV San Pedro: 60 EUR
  • IEDMT: 0% (PHEV, 15 g/km) = 0 EUR
  • DGT, plates, IVTM pro rata: 300 EUR
  • Importer fee including pre-purchase inspection in Germany: 750 EUR
  • Total on Spanish plates: 46,890 EUR. Saving versus local: 9,000-12,000 EUR.

The foreign plates trap on the Costa

The Guardia Civil runs regular checks on the A-7 and in urbanisations targeting foreign-plated cars driven by residents. A resident driving on UK, Dutch or German plates beyond the registration period faces a 500 EUR fine, immobilisation and a follow-up from AEAT for the unpaid registration tax. If you have been here more than a couple of months on foreign plates, register the car or replace it now; the exemption disappears at day 60 of residence and the fines start soon after.

I am not resident but keep a car at my Marbella apartment. Can I register it here?

Yes. Non-residents can register a car at a Spanish property using the NIE and the deed or a rental contract. It removes the 6-month limit on foreign plates and makes insurance and ITV straightforward. IEDMT applies normally; the residence exemption does not.

Is it safe to buy a car in Germany without seeing it?

With a pre-purchase inspection by an independent engineer (100-250 EUR) and a dealer that provides a full service history and a written guarantee, yes; German consumer law gives you a 12-month minimum warranty from dealers even as a foreign buyer. Private sales are riskier and better done in person or through an importer who inspects and collects.

How long from choosing a car in Germany to plates in Marbella?

Two to four weeks is typical: inspection and purchase in a few days, transport a week, ITV and AEAT filing within days of arrival, DGT registration one to two weeks.
